Key Replacements For Cars

Land-Rover.pngMisplacing keys to your car isn't fun, but it's even less pleasant when you don't have spare keys. This is why it's crucial to keep a few key replacement options in mind.

Begin by noting down your vehicle identification number (VIN). This will assist you in finding locksmiths or dealers who supports your model.

Mechanical Keys

The most basic kind of car key is a mechanical one that doesn't come with an electronic chip embedded in it. A few dollars can be spent at the local hardware store or locksmith shop to obtain duplicate keys. If, however, you've lost your original car keys or it's been stolen you'll need to find a professional that specializes in the replacement of keys for cars. The cost of this service can vary depending on the make and model of your car.

If you have a newer car, your key is a transponder, with an electronic chip that is hidden within. These keys look like mechanical keys, but they transmit a code to your car every time you insert them in the ignition. This ensures that the key is a compatible key. If the identifier codes do match and your car will not start.

This technology can add an additional layer of security to your vehicle, but it also makes it more difficult for people outside of the authorized dealer network to pair keys with your specific cheapest car key replacement. You'll have to visit your local car dealer to exchange a transponder. You'll also have to provide proof of ownership. This can be a hassle and can add to the overall cost of the service.

Transponder Keys

Transponder keys contain the microchip that transmits an audio signal when they are in close proximity to the car. The radio signals from the vehicle trigger the chip, which then transmits a unique code to the vehicle computer. If the computer can recognize this code, it will deactivate the immobilizer and allow the engine to begin. If the code isn't recognized, the vehicle will shut down. These keys are harder to duplicate than non-transponder keys. They are therefore considered to be a more secure alternative.

But that doesn't mean that they are totally secure from theft. Some thieves who are skilled and skilled have discovered ways to start cars using these keys. If you are concerned about someone hot wiring your car, you may want to choose a key which is not transponder.

There are several different types of transponder keys, such as the blade style that needs to be inserted into the ignition and the fob-style that stays in the pocket or purse. They all require a professional to program them for your specific vehicle. It is better to go to an automotive locksmith than your dealer to replace a transponder keys that's been lost or stolen. They have the specialist equipment to correctly program your key.

Laser-Cut Keys

Traditional keys operate by using a blade that is able to move past pins within the lock cylinder. Keys of this kind are easy to duplicate and don't come with any additional features that boost security. Keys made with lasers look different. They have a constant depth across the middle, and less grooves, which changes how the key rotates in the lock cylinder. This design makes them more durable and harder to pick. Laser-cut keys have a transponder built in, which is unique for each vehicle. This stops unauthorized use of the vehicle.

Laser-cut keys provide greater security. These keys are also known as internal cut keys or sidewinder keys because of the cut-out on the blade. The notch permits the blades of the key to slide into the lock from both sides to open it. Laser-cut keys also feature a unique key pattern, which is why they are extremely difficult to duplicate without the right equipment.

Smart Keys

Smart keys are a novel type of car key that utilizes radio-frequency identification (RFID) technology to communicate with your vehicle. The key is embedded with an individual code that is only recognized by your vehicle. When the key is within reach of the vehicle, it can unlock the doors and start the engine.

Smart key systems are growing in popularity due to a number of benefits, including convenience and security. A majority of smart keys have the ability to be in close proximity, which activates courtesy lighting as you approach the car. This will help you locate your car in a parking area and is particularly useful when your hands are full of food items or other things.

Additionally, some smart keys have the ability to turn on your car remotely. This lets you turn on your car using your phone. This is especially useful when you're working late or you need to transport your children to school.

While smart keys are more secure than traditional keys for cars however, they do have weaknesses. Hackers can intercept the encrypted signals that connect with the car and use them for criminal motives, such as for theft of vehicles. This is why it is essential to keep your smart key safe and ensure that the battery is not dead.
